Model 93R17-F -- now with AccuTrigger
Caliber .17 HMR
Overall Length 39.5"
Barrel Length 20.75"
Weight 5 lbs
Magazine Capacity 5 rounds
Stock Black synthetic
Sights No sights. Scope bases installed.
Rifling Rate of Twist 1 in 9"
Features New AccuTrigger, blued bolt action, free-floating, button-rifled barrel, swivel studs with detachable magazine.
